From mboxrd@z Thu Jan 1 00:00:00 1970 From: David Miller Date: Tue, 21 Dec 2010 18:53:30 +0000 Subject: Re: [patch -next] stmmac: unwind properly in stmmac_dvr_probe() Message-Id: <20101221.105330.104073991.davem@davemloft.net> List-Id: References: <20101221073456.GG1936@bicker> In-Reply-To: <20101221073456.GG1936@bicker> M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: error27@gmail.com Cc: peppe.cavallaro@st.com, netdev@vger.kernel.org, kernel-janitors@vger.kernel.org From: Dan Carpenter Date: Tue, 21 Dec 2010 10:34:56 +0300 > The original code had a several problems: > *) It had potential null dereferences of "priv" and "res". > *) It released the memory region before it was aquired. > *) It didn't free "ndev" after it was allocated. > *) It didn't call unregister_netdev() after calling stmmac_probe(). > > Signed-off-by: Dan Carpenter Nice work, applied. Thanks Dan.